UWM Power Energy Lab Info

The University of Wisconsin-Milwaukee (UWM) Power Energy Lab is a state-of-the-art research facility dedicated to advancing the field of power engineering and energy systems. As a leading institution in the region, UWM's Power Energy Lab plays a critical role in addressing the complex energy challenges facing the world today. With a strong focus on innovation and collaboration, the lab brings together faculty, students, and industry partners to develop cutting-edge solutions for a sustainable energy future.

Located in the heart of Milwaukee, the Power Energy Lab is equipped with advanced equipment and software, enabling researchers to conduct experiments, simulations, and analysis in a wide range of areas, including power electronics, electric machines, and energy storage systems. The lab's research focus areas include renewable energy integration, smart grid technologies, and energy efficiency, among others. By leveraging its expertise and resources, the Power Energy Lab aims to drive technological advancements and promote sustainable energy practices, ultimately contributing to a more environmentally friendly and economically viable energy infrastructure.
